Yes, a DS unit can have more than one kind of element. You have to watch what you mix together though. 1 GMS tank, 2 SLAM tanks & 2 HVC tanks is a good mix; 3 Artillery, 1 ZAD, 1 supply truck is a good unit. Mixing Artillery and GMS or having different motive types isn't. With the force you want below, it does work within the rules, but tactically, you're probably better with 2 separate units, as they have entirely different mission profiles. A size 2 VTOL with 2 stands and a GMS/L can stand alone. The gunships should be used as tank hunters to seek and destroy ZAD units, Command units and enemy artillery. I've found them to be too fragile for the main battleline.
